How Our Behind Wall Water Extraction Process Works

When water seeps behind your walls, it’s essential to act quickly to prevent further damage. Our team follows a strict process to ensure your home is restored to its original condition. We’ll start by containing the affected area to prevent water from spreading. Next, we’ll use specialized equipment to extract the water and dry out the walls. Finally, we’ll use antimicrobial treatments to prevent mold and mildew growth.

Step 1: Containment

Our technicians will set up a containment system to prevent water from spreading to other areas of your home. This includes sealing off doors and windows and setting up a negative air pressure system to remove moisture from the air. Our goal is to prevent further damage and ensure a safe working environment.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use specialized equipment to extract the water from behind your walls. This includes truck-mounted extractors and portable pumps to remove excess water. Our technicians will work quickly to reduce downtime and prevent further damage.

Step 3: Drying

Once the water is extracted, we’ll use specialized equipment to dry out your walls. This includes desiccant dehumidifiers and air movers to remove moisture from the air. Our goal is to dry out your walls completely to prevent mold and mildew growth.

Step 4: Antimicrobial Treatment

Finally, we’ll use antimicrobial treatments to prevent mold and mildew growth. This includes applying a specialized solution to the affected area and allowing it to dry. Our goal is to ensure your home is completely safe and healthy.

Warning Signs You Need Behind Wall Water Extraction

Catching these signs early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ent bigger problems down the road. Don’t ignore the following warning signs: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

A musty smell can be a sign of mold and mildew growth behind your walls. If you notice a persistent odor, it’s time to call our team. We’ll use specialized equipment to identify the source of the smell and provide a solution.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Water stains can be a sign of a hidden leak behind your walls. If you notice water stains, it’s essential to act quickly to prevent further damage. Our team will inspect your walls and provide a plan to repair the damage.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of moisture issues behind your walls. If you notice peeling paint or wallpaper, it’s time to call our team. We’ll inspect your walls and provide a solution to prevent further damage.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age behind your walls. If you notice warped or buckled flooring, it’s essential to act quickly to prevent further damage. Our team will inspect your flooring and provide a plan to repair the damage.

Increased Humidity

Increased humidity can be a sign of moisture issues behind your walls. If you notice increased humidity, it’s time to call our team. We’ll inspect your walls and provide a solution to prevent further damage.

Unexplained Mold Growth

Unexplained mold growth can be a sign of moisture issues behind your walls. If you notice mold growth, it’s essential to act quickly to prevent further damage. Our team will inspect your walls and provide a solution to prevent further damage.

Behind Wall Water Extraction Cost In Enumclaw, WA

The cost of Behind Wall Water Ext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Enumclaw, WA. Our estimates are based on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Containment $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area and complexity of containment
Water Extraction $1,000 – $5,000 Amount of water extracted and equipment needed
Drying $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area and equipment needed
Antimicrobial Treatment $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area and type of treatment needed

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ates to ensure you know exactly what to expect.
